• Час читання ~0 хв
  • 10.12.2022

PhpStorm, PHP IDE від JetBrains, випустив версію 2022.3 цього тижня з новим інтерфейсом користувача, підтримкою PHP 8.2, швидким попереднім переглядом, переглядом коду, режимом читання для PHPDocs тощо.

Цей випуск містить вражаючі значні покращення та безліч невеликих покращень якості життя. Ось суть усього, що заслуговує на увагу, з посиланням на повну публікацію оголошення нижче для повного списку всього:

  • Новий інтерфейс користувача (попередній перегляд)
  • Підтримка PHP 8.2, наприклад класи лише для читання, застарілі динамічні властивості, покращення системи типів тощо.
  • Бачення коду – показує такі речі, як власники коду, використання та кількість реалізацій інтерфейсів
  • Попередній перегляд швидкого виправлення
  • Режим читання для блоків PHPDoc
  • Покращена швидка документація
  • Попередній перегляд формату дати й часу
  • База даних: підтримка Redis
  • Виконуйте тести за допомогою ParaTest
  • Виконуйте окремі набори даних із постачальниками даних PHPUnit
  • Використовуйте інструменти зовнішнього форматування, такі як PHP CS Fixer або PHP Codesniffer
  • Підтримка глузування пророцтва
  • Покращення леза
  • І більше

Цей випуск PhpStorm вражає, і мені подобаються всі нові вдосконалення. Новий інтерфейс користувача гарний і виглядає новим!

Незважаючи на те, що всі ці нові функції захоплюють, ми все-таки новини Laravel! Отже, що конкретно покращилось у PhpStorm для Laravel?

Спеціально для Блейда було згадано дві речі:

  • Тепер директиви закриття автоматично закриватимуться, коли це можливо.
  • Виявлення використання коду також покращено у файлах Blade, тому ви маєте бачити менше хибного підсвічування під час використання.

Вивчайте більше

Якщо вам подобається візуальне зображення, прихильник розробників PhpStorm Брент Руз розповідає про нові можливості у цьому відео:

Щоб отримати повне повідомлення про випуск, перегляньте Повідомлення про PhpStorm 2022.3.

Comments

No comments yet
Yurij Finiv

Yurij Finiv

Full stack

Про мене

Professional Fullstack Developer with extensive experience in website and desktop application development. Proficient in a wide range of tools and technologies, including Bootstrap, Tailwind, HTML5, CSS3, PUG, JavaScript, Alpine.js, jQuery, PHP, MODX, and Node.js. Skilled in website development using Symfony, MODX, and Laravel. Experience: Contributed to the development and translation of MODX3 i...

Про автора CrazyBoy49z
WORK EXPERIENCE
Контакти
Ukraine, Lutsk
+380979856297